How they compare

Georgia currently reports 1,261 TDS, current US$ per person against 1,047 TDS, current US$ per person in Türkiye, a difference of 214 TDS, current US$ per person.

That makes Georgia's figure about 1.2 times Türkiye's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 32 shared years of data; in 1993 it was Türkiye ahead.

Georgia ranks 7th and Türkiye ranks 9th of 121 countries.

Türkiye has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Georgia Türkiye Difference Ahead
1990s 14.25 TDS, current US$ per person 198.94 TDS, current US$ per person 184.69 TDS, current US$ per person Türkiye
2000s 76.24 TDS, current US$ per person 552.36 TDS, current US$ per person 476.12 TDS, current US$ per person Türkiye
2010s 528.13 TDS, current US$ per person 879.7 TDS, current US$ per person 351.57 TDS, current US$ per person Türkiye
2020s 886.91 TDS, current US$ per person 934.59 TDS, current US$ per person 47.68 TDS, current US$ per person Türkiye

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
